Here is what Hoover did plan to end the depression:
1. Use of volunteerism to create economic solutions at the state and local level (no federal restrictions or use of money)
**indirect relief to those that were jobless
**price stabilization by businesses
2. Create government organizations to facilitate economic help and communicate between labor and corporations.
3. Indirect aid to banks and public works projects (like Hoover Dam)
